    Why is my Whirlpool Energy Smart 188410 not producing enough hot water?
    • K
      Kelly NewtonJul 30, 2025
      Several factors could be responsible for insufficient hot water. It could be due to a defective dip tube, or the temperature might be set too low. Sediment or lime accumulation in the tank can also cause this issue, as well as wrong piping connections. Check for leaking faucets and plumbing, and consider whether the heater is adequately sized for your needs. Also, wasted hot water, and long runs of exposed or uninsulated pipe can contribute.

    How to reduce high operation costs for my Whirlpool Water Heater?
    • D
      David WilliamsAug 7, 2025
      To reduce high operation costs, first ensure the temperature isn't set too high, consider using the Energy Smart® Mode. Draining and flushing the tank to remove sediment or lime is also important. Other factors include: repairing leaking faucets and plumbing, reducing wasted hot water, and insulating exposed piping. If the elements are covered with sediment or lime, consider replacing them. Finally, ensure you have an adequately sized heater for your needs.

    Why is my Whirlpool Energy Smart 188410's T&P valve dripping?
    • K
      Kristi HarrisonAug 22, 2025
      A dripping T&P valve could be due to excessive water pressure. Alternatively, it might be related to a closed system. It could also be caused by a defective T&P valve, which would need to be replaced.
